Níðhöggr is the Type Maiden with Fusion Guardian Embryo of Cata Lugang Euanjelion.

Appearance[]

In her Maiden form, Níðhöggr wears a hat that covers her eyes and sleeves long enough to cover her mouth when she eats. In her Guardian form, she is over 100m in size, however, she rarely transforms into this state due to a certain policy of Cata's.

Personality[]

Níðhöggr is usually taciturn, and dislikes people who hinders Cata.

Abilities[]

As a Fusion Guardian, Níðhöggr can fuse her body with Cata's, and neither will die in this state as long as they are not both eliminated and allows her to control Cata's body in the event that he was incapable of doing so. However, she can only somewhat control Cata's body as long as Cata's own brain is intact. She is also unable to use any of her skills unless she is fused with Cata. She can also transform parts of her body into her Guardian form.

Skills[]

  • Unnamed skill: An active skill that can create additional mouths on Cata's body, such as his palms, arms, shoulder, feet and torso. By creating a mouth on the palm and distending its chin to the limit, it is possible to extend the mouth to almost the length of Cata's arm. This skill has a limit to how much area it can cover, however, the limiting factor, whether volume, quantity of mouths, or something else, is unknown.
  • Expanding Life (膨張する命): A passive skill that allows Níðhöggr to store the resources of everything she has eaten which she can use to substitute the costs of Cata's skills. As a side effect, Níðhöggr's Guardian body increases proportional to the amount of resources she has currently stored. However, even if its size increases, its status does not increases to match it which results in too big of a body being unable to move whenever she accumulates too much resources as it cannot support its own weight.
  • Craving (渇望の牙クレイヴィング): A passive skill that reduces a creature's resistance by 50% at the moment they are bitten and subtracts the maximum value of the END and hardness of an object that has been eaten before from what is currently being eaten. In order to activate this skill, a certain amount of a substance must be chewed and swallowed, which changes depending on the object. Currently, the amount that can be subtracted is equal to the END of compressed Mythical metal, or 120,000 END.
  • Law of the Jungle (弱肉強食ロウ・オブ・ザ・ジャングル): The final skill that Níðhöggr acquired after evolving into a Superior Embryo. It allows Cata to acquire one skill of a UBM by eating their corresponding special reward that he has ownership over. After eating it, a black tattoo corresponding to the eaten special reward appears on the skin of Cata (and Níðhöggr guardian body) while they are fused whose colour changes from black to gray and finally into white whenever the corresponding skill is used. A minimum interval of 24 hours is needed in order to re-use said corresponding skill and Cata can still use the skill while it is still recovering as long as the corresponding tattoo has not completely turned white. However, skills that require special costs to be paid and skills that require specific body parts cannot be used properly. Cata also has a limit on the number of skills he can stock and once it is full, he is incapable of gaining a new one without deleting some skills in his stock. The amount of the capacity consumed by the stocked skill increases proportional to how high the rank of the special reward consumed to gain said skill. The higher the rank of the special reward eaten, the longer Cata can use the skill, though the higher its rank is too, the longer the time it takes to re-use said skill once the tattoo of said skill turns white. Special rewards devoured with this skill are lost forever.
    • Dragon King Aura (竜王気): An active skill possessed by all Dragon Kings. It creates a field of energy that can reduce the power of attacks and by using it to reinforce their own attacks, increase their power immensely. Because the aura can resist attacks of all attributes, the specific resistance level for each attribute is not high. By using the stored resources inside Níðhöggr, Cata can produce an extremely thick layer of Dragon King Aura rivalling Canglong Ren Yue.
    • Last Supper (最後の晩餐): A skill that causes the flesh and blood that has been separated from the body to become a hungry dragon. Additionally, Hungry Dragons born from Cata's body is also capable of using Níðhöggr's skill, Craving as they are judged to be a part of Cata's body.
  • Níðhöggr — Food From Underworld's Hearth ((黄泉竈食ニーズヘッグ): Níðhöggr's ultimate skill. An active skill that causes all creatures killed by Cata while the skill is active to leave behind a corpse that contains all of their resources. This causes all monsters killed by Cata to not drop even a single drop item and instead leave behind a corpse that he can eat to absorb their resources much more efficiently.

Trivia[]

  • Níðhöggr is stated to require the most food expenses among Type:Maiden Embryos as she eats Mythical metals as snacks.
  • Níðhöggr had an opportunity to evolve into a Superior Embryo over a year ago but prevented herself from evolving. This caused her to be unable to properly use her skill, Expanding Life as doing so would force her to let go of her restraint and then evolve into a Superior Embryo.
  • Whenever Níðhöggr fuses with Cata in a state where majority of Cata's body has transformed into a white beast, Cata's race changes from a human into a chimera.
